Moog Australia, a subsidiary of Moog Inc. (NYSE: MOG.A and MOG.B), has signed a contract with Lockheed Martin Australia (LMA) for the Guided Multiple Launch Rocket System (GMLRS) control actuation system (CAS) development. The contract positions Moog to support a growing portfolio of sovereign capability with Lockheed Martin Australia, the Australian Defence Force (ADF), and the Commonwealth of Australia (CoA). This achievement follows an investment by Moog to bring the guided weapons pathfinder program to the Moog Australia site. GMLRS is a combat-proven, precision-guided rocket deployable by High Mobility Artillery Rocket System (HIMARS) and M270 MLRS launchers.
